小虎建站知识网,分享建站知识,包括:建站行业动态、建站百科知识、SEO优化知识等知识。建站服务热线:180-5191-0076

个人网站的代码;个人网站的代码是什么

  • 个,人网,站的,代码,是什么,当,你在,浏览器,
  • 建站百科知识-小虎建站百科知识网
  • 2026-02-10 00:48
  • 小虎建站百科知识网

个人网站的代码;个人网站的代码是什么 ,对于想了解建站百科知识的朋友们来说,个人网站的代码;个人网站的代码是什么是一个非常想了解的问题,下面小编就带领大家看看这个问题。

当你在浏览器输入一个网址时,是否想过那些跳动的文字与图像背后,藏着怎样的数字基因?个人网站代码就像数字世界的DNA链,既是技术实现的骨架,也是个性表达的载体。本文将带你拆解这串神秘代码的六个核心维度,揭开从零搭建个人网站的技术面纱。

前端三剑客架构

HTML是网站的骨骼框架,用标签语言搭建内容结构。每个`
`如同建筑中的钢梁,`

`标签则是填充空间的砖块。最新HTML5标准新增了`

`等语义化标签,让代码更易读且利于SEO。

CSS则是视觉化妆师,通过选择器精准定位元素。Flexbox布局实现响应式设计,媒体查询(@media)让网站在手机端自动适配。动画效果通过`@keyframes`实现,比如悬停时的渐变色过渡。

JavaScript赋予网站灵魂,`addEventListener`让按钮产生交互反馈。AJAX技术实现无刷新加载,而ES6的箭头函数让代码更简洁。三大技术如同齿轮咬合,共同驱动前端展示。

后端引擎选择

PHP仍是个人网站的主流选择,WordPress基于其构建,`$_GET`和`$_POST`处理表单数据。但Node.js正快速崛起,用`express.Router`创建路由更高效,非阻塞I/O适合高并发场景。

Python的Django框架采用MVT模式,自带Admin后台省去开发时间。Ruby on Rails遵循"约定优于配置",`rails generate`命令可快速搭建CRUD功能。选择时需权衡学习曲线与项目需求。

数据库方面,MySQL用`JOIN`实现多表关联查询,MongoDB的BSON格式适合存储非结构化数据。轻量级SQLite无需服务器配置,是个人项目的便捷之选。

SEO优化核心

个人网站的代码;个人网站的代码是什么

语义化HTML标签是基础,`

`至`

`形成内容层级。``要包含2-3个核心关键词,长度控制在155字符内。结构化数据标记用JSON-LD格式,帮助搜索引擎理解内容。

页面速度直接影响排名,CSS精灵图减少HTTP请求,WebP格式替代传统JPEG。延迟加载(`loading="lazy"`)优先渲染可视区域内容。GTmetrix工具可检测性能瓶颈。

内容策略上,长尾关键词布局要自然,比如"个人博客搭建教程"比"建站"更具针对性。内部链接使用描述性锚文本,外部链接需指向权威站点,权重传递更有效。

安全防护机制

个人网站的代码;个人网站的代码是什么

HTTPS加密是底线,Let's Encrypt提供免费证书。SQL注入防护需使用参数化查询,PHP中应弃用`mysql_`系列函数。XSS攻击防范要对输出内容做`htmlspecialchars`转义。

密码存储必须哈希处理,PHP的`password_hash`采用bcrypt算法。CSRF令牌需嵌入表单,验证请求来源合法性。定期备份可采用`crontab`自动执行数据库导出。

防火墙规则设置很关键,`.htaccess`文件限制敏感目录访问。错误日志要记录但不可公开,避免暴露系统路径等信息。安全如同防盗门,既要坚固又不能影响正常使用。

移动端适配策略

视口meta标签``是响应式基石。REM单位配合根字体大小实现等比缩放,避免px的绝对尺寸。触摸事件需替换鼠标事件,`touchstart`比`click`响应更快。

图片服务可采用``元素,根据设备加载不同尺寸源文件。下拉刷新功能通过`touchmove`事件阈值判断实现。PWA技术让网站具备APP特性,manifest文件定义图标和启动画面。

测试阶段要用Chrome设备模拟器,同时需真机验证。iOS的Safari对CSS渐变支持特殊,需添加`-webkit-`前缀。移动体验如同定制西装,必须精确测量每个尺寸。

持续迭代路径

Git版本控制是必备技能,`git rebase`保持提交历史整洁。分支策略建议采用Git Flow,`feature/`前缀区分功能开发。`.gitignore`文件要排除编译产物和敏感配置。

自动化部署可通过GitHub Actions实现,yml文件定义测试流程。Docker容器化保证环境一致性,`Dockerfile`声明依赖项。CDN加速用`